If you have a Health Savings Account as part of your insurance plan you must stop contributions if you sign up for any part of Medicare. IRS rules will not allow you to contribute to a HSA if you are enrolled in any part of Medicare. Also when you do enrole make sure you fix your Medicare enrollment date after you stop your HSA contributions.

It is apparent that the author has not had a security clearence. If a government employee has a clearence, such a person is not allowed access to classified material unless there is a "need to know". Also the public publication of classified material does not make it unclassified. Given this it is a security infraction to read such material. Hence the warning to government employees and other who hold security clearences.
